Sustainability is in our DNA
Our facility at 945 Princess is one of Canada’s largest deep energy retrofits, set to cut carbon emissions by over 80% by 2025.
​
Together, we push the boundaries of what’s possible—transforming a neglected building into a model of sustainability and holding ourselves and our ventures to the highest standards. When it comes to combating climate change, there are no shortcuts.

Chemistry has a reputation for getting a little messy. Historically, products and processes were developed to solve major industrial challenges—think early plastics revolutionizing manufacturing or synthetic fertilizers boosting global food production. But with greater knowledge, we’ve come to understand the unintended consequences—environmental impact, resource depletion, and toxicity concerns. No single technology holds all the answers, so we take a holistic approach to help innovators drive progress in the most critical areas.
